SZE CHE SAU AND OTHERS v. DRAGAGES ET TRAVAUX PUBLICS (HK) LTD AND OTHERS

SZE CHE SAU AND OTHERS v. DRAGAGES ET TRAVAUX PUBLICS (HK) LTD AND OTHERS

Court found Ng and Chung & Ng Consulting Engineers Ltd. negligent and in breach of statutory duties for failing to supervise temporary works: falsework lacked required lateral bracing, had missing diagonal braces and did not meet required loading capacity; these failures materially contributed to the collapse. Apportionment of liability fixed at 70% to the principal contractor (D1) and 30% to Ng and CN; CN vicariously liable for acts of Ng and Wong; costs ordered accordingly.

  1. 1 Whether Ng and CN were liable in tort to the plaintiffs for negligence and breaches of statutory duty
  2. 2 If liable, apportionment of liability between the principal contractor (D1) and Ng/CN
  3. 3 Whether breaches of the Buildings Ordinance, OSHO and Occupiers Liability Ordinance were established

Ratio Decidendi

Court found Ng and Chung & Ng Consulting Engineers Ltd. negligent and in breach of statutory duties for failing to supervise temporary works: falsework lacked required lateral bracing, had missing diagonal braces and did not meet required loading capacity; these failures materially contributed to the collapse. Apportionment of liability fixed at 70% to the principal contractor (D1) and 30% to Ng and CN; CN vicariously liable for acts of Ng and Wong; costs ordered accordingly.

Court Disposition

Liability established: judgment on liability entered against D1 in favour of plaintiffs (by consent); negligence and breaches of statutory duty proven against Ng and CN; contribution ordered and apportionment fixed.

Orders

  • Apportion liability: D1 70% and Ng and Chung & Ng Consulting Engineers Ltd. 30%
  • Order nisi that costs of D1's contribution and third party proceedings be costs to D1 against Ng and CN
